English Premier League | 2018-19 Season

Rank Teams Played Won Drawn Lost Differential Goal difference Points Current form
1 Man CityMan City 38 32 2 4 95 - 23 72 98 WWWWW
2 LiverpoolLiverpool 38 30 7 1 89 - 22 67 97 WWWWW
3 ChelseaChelsea 38 21 9 8 63 - 39 24 72 LDDWD
4 TottenhamTottenham 38 23 2 13 67 - 39 28 71 LWLLD
5 ArsenalArsenal 38 21 7 10 73 - 51 22 70 LLLDW
6 Man UtdMan Utd 38 19 9 10 65 - 54 11 66 LLDDL
7 WolverhamptonWolverhampton 38 16 9 13 47 - 46 1 57 DWWWL
8 EvertonEverton 38 15 9 14 54 - 46 8 54 LWDWD
9 LeicesterLeicester 38 15 7 16 51 - 48 3 52 LDWLD
10 West HamWest Ham 38 15 7 16 52 - 55 -3 52 LDWWW
11 WatfordWatford 38 14 8 16 52 - 59 -7 50 WDLLL
12 Crystal PalaceCrystal Palace 38 14 7 17 51 - 53 -2 49 LWDWW
13 NewcastleNewcastle 38 12 9 17 42 - 48 -6 45 WWDLW
14 BournemouthBournemouth 38 13 6 19 56 - 70 -14 45 WLDWL
15 BurnleyBurnley 38 11 7 20 45 - 68 -23 40 WDLLL
16 SouthamptonSouthampton 38 9 12 17 45 - 65 -20 39 LDDLD
17 BrightonBrighton 38 9 9 20 35 - 60 -25 36 DLDDL
18 CardiffCardiff 38 10 4 24 34 - 69 -35 34 WLLLW
19 FulhamFulham 38 7 5 26 34 - 81 -47 26 WWWLL
20 Huddersfield TownHuddersfield Town 38 3 7 28 22 - 76 -54 16 LLLDD
